TmNbRu₂ is an intermetallic compound composed of thulium, niobium, and ruthenium, representing a rare-earth transition metal system. This material is primarily of research interest rather than established commercial use, studied for potential applications in high-temperature structural applications and advanced functional materials where the combination of rare-earth and refractory metal elements may offer unique property combinations. The material's potential relevance lies in emerging technologies requiring materials with tailored electronic, magnetic, or thermal properties in extreme environments.
